About Haiyang Dai

Haiyang Dai is a scholar working on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Materials Chemistry and Condensed Matter Physics, having authored 25 papers that have together received 388 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Multiferroics and related materials (17 papers), Ferroelectric and Piezoelectric Materials (13 papers) and Dielectric properties of ceramics (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(273 citations), Materials Chemistry (326 citations) and Condensed Matter Physics (53 citations). Haiyang Dai has collaborated with scholars based in China. Frequent co-authors include Zhenping Chen, Dewei Liu, Tao Li, Renzhong Xue, Tao Li, Tao Li, Zhiquan Chen, T. Li, Baoyi Wang and Xingzhong Cao.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Alloys and Compounds, Journal of Magnetism and Magnetic Materials and Journal of Solid State Chemistry.
